As of the current reporting date, no recent earnings data is available for Pacific (PCG^D), the 5% 1st Red. Preferred Stock issued by Pacific Gas & Electric Co. Unlike common stock disclosures that regularly include line-item earnings per share and revenue figures, preferred stock series often have limited standalone quarterly disclosures, with performance tied closely to the parent company’s broader financial health and ability to meet fixed dividend obligations. Management Commentary

No formal management commentary tied to a standalone PCG^D earnings release has been issued in recent weeks, in line with standard disclosure practices for this type of preferred security. However, parent company leadership has shared updates on broader organizational priorities in recent public appearances, including ongoing investments in grid modernization, wildfire risk reduction programs, and ongoing negotiations with state regulators around rate adjustments. Leadership has also referenced efforts to strengthen the company’s balance sheet and maintain sufficient liquidity to meet all priority payment obligations, which would likely include the fixed 5% dividend owed to PCG^D holders, given preferred stock’s seniority to common stock distributions. Management has not announced any planned changes to the terms of the PCG^D series, including redemption schedules or dividend adjustments, in recent public statements. Forward Guidance

No specific forward guidance tied to PCG^D’s standalone performance has been released alongside recent earnings disclosures, as no such disclosures have been filed for the security. The parent company’s broader public guidance references expected capital expenditure levels for upcoming infrastructure projects, potential timelines for regulatory rate adjustment decisions, and targeted debt reduction milestones for the upcoming months. These factors could possibly impact the long-term financial position supporting PCG^D’s dividend obligations, though analysts estimate based on available public data that the company’s current liquidity buffer is sufficient to cover all preferred dividend payments in the near term. No guidance has been issued regarding potential redemption of the PCG^D series in the upcoming months, and management has not signaled any plans to adjust the preferred stock’s fixed dividend structure. Market Reaction

In the absence of specific earnings news for PCG^D, trading activity for the security in recent weeks has reflected normal trading activity for investment-grade utility preferred stocks. Price movements have largely tracked broader fixed-income market trends, as well as investor sentiment around regulatory updates affecting Pacific’s operational and financial outlook. Trading volumes for PCG^D have been near average levels this month, with no unusual volatility tied to unconfirmed earnings rumors or speculative reports. Analysts covering the utility sector note that investor sentiment toward PCG^D may shift if upcoming regulatory announcements include material changes to the company’s allowed rate of return or liability profile, though no such announcements are currently scheduled for the immediate term. The security’s performance has also been correlated with moves in benchmark interest rates, as is typical for fixed-dividend preferred securities, with price movements aligned with broader sector trends for comparable utility preferred issuances.
